Output 86a9a1149c2846d2eba67197d95e0670931109a248045d4b2a6f089e4dae7e3e:0

value
310218121
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 290b08db27dfc85a654d7f3fb4e9f9bb85197d76 OP_EQUALVERIFY OP_CHECKSIG
address
14k1vZbr95AK34uDwWBnTMrCb6WH2hsbiC
transaction
86a9a1149c2846d2eba67197d95e0670931109a248045d4b2a6f089e4dae7e3e
confirmations
586724
spent
true